Core Technical Requirements

\n
    \n
  • Strong experience with Snowflake for data warehousing, including writing efficient SQL and managing schemas.
  • \n
  • Proficiency in Airflow for orchestration and workflow management.
  • \n
  • Hands-on experience with AWS services, particularly S3 for storage and Lambda for serverless processing.
  • \n
  • Familiarity with Kafka concepts (producers, consumers, topics) and ability to integrate with streaming data pipelines.
  • \n
  • Solid understanding of data modelling, ETL/ELT processes, and performance optimization.
  • \n
\n

Programming & Engineering Skills

\n
    \n
  • Proficiency in Python for data engineering tasks and automation.
  • \n
  • Ability to design and implement scalable, maintainable data pipelines.
  • \n
  • Experience with version control systems (e.g., Git) and collaborative development workflows.
  • \n
\n

Leadership & Mentorship

\n
    \n
  • Ability to lead technical initiatives within the team and drive best practices.
  • \n
  • Experience in mentoring junior engineers, providing guidance on coding standards, design patterns, and career development.
  • \n
  • Comfortable with code reviews and fostering a culture of continuous improvement.
  • \n
\n

Best Practices & Mindset

\n
    \n
  • Strong grasp of data quality principles, including validation and monitoring.
  • \n
  • Ability to read, understand, and refactor existing code effectively.
  • \n
  • Familiarity with CI/CD practices for data pipeline deployment.
  • \n
  • Comfortable working in cloud-native environments and following security/compliance standards.
  • \n
\n

Nice-to-Have

\n
    \n
  • Exposure to streaming data architectures and event-driven systems.
  • \n
  • Knowledge of Snowflake performance tuning and cost optimization.
  • \n
